SalaCyber Practical Penetration Testing (SPPT)

SalaCyber Practice Penetration Testing course provides offensive approach to perform security test on target boundary and to give students ability to attack the system infrastructures by acquiring hand-on skill on real-world cyber-security.

What you'll learn

  • Conduct penetration testing with a structured methodology
  • Gather information passively and actively; scan for vulnerabilities
  • Find and exploit targets; perform privilege escalation
  • Use Metasploit for exploitation
  • Exploit buffer overflows: EIP overwrite, shellcode, bad chars
  • Test Active Directory environments
  • Assess web applications: XSS, CSRF, SQLi, SSRF, IDOR

Prerequisites

  • SEHE (Ethical Hacking Essential)
  • SKLE (Kali Linux Essential)
  • Understanding of networks and systems
